Over the years, I explored various forms of exercise, including Brazilian jiu-jitsu and gymnastics. Finally, I stumbled upon powerlifting, which connected with me due to its simplicity and focus on three compound movements. Although I saw success in strength and ability, the demanding nature of powerlifting began to take a toll on me. Training sessions consumed around 80 minutes a day and left me feeling mentally drained and physically exhausted.

When my daughter was born in March 2020, the pandemic closed gym doors, forcing me to rethink my fitness journey entirely. Faced with the reality of fatherhood, I contemplated letting go of my training, but it quickly became apparent that I needed to make a change not just for myself, but for my family as well.
